How they compare

Marshall Islands currently reports 17.6% against 17.3% in Bahamas, a difference of 0.3%.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 6 shared years of data; in 2015 it was Bahamas ahead.

Bahamas ranks 56th and Marshall Islands ranks 55th of 175 countries.

Bahamas has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
